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Pat shrimp dry with paper towels and season with salt and pepper.
  2. Step 2: Heat 2 tbsp ol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ering. Add shrimp in a single layer and cook for 2 minutes per side until pink and opaque.
  3. Step 3: Add 4 minced garlic cloves and cook for 1 minute until fragrant, stirring constantly to prevent burning.
  4. Step 4: Stir in 1/2 lemon juice and cook for 30 seconds. Serve immediately, garnished with 2 tbsp chopped fresh parsley.

How do I store leftover Pan-Fried Shrimp with Garlic?

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ep peeled and deveined shrimp from drying out.

How do I scale Pan-Fried Shrimp with Garlic for a different number of people?

The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
